Output 74521857bdd5fd94a9d3d92244cedbe589ded339652faa0d0832d88413508d6a:4

value
1333280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73fac1aa4912c74169d869df7c91d53a1ed72772 OP_EQUALVERIFY OP_CHECKSIG
address
1BaF6vpPmAtxW5kE6sfzDZGonCgBHoCnvP
transaction
74521857bdd5fd94a9d3d92244cedbe589ded339652faa0d0832d88413508d6a
confirmations
411353
spent
true